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3641 281 3661107008 7161874 5216320
17 81410240 538
17 81410240 538
3466656 08265659 0467424
All about undefined
Interested in learning more?
17 81410240 538
3466656 08265659 0467424
See more
88521395724 4382201888
6750950 834287 02572425915
See more
8896 51923958
4441476706 6091 549 61950697839
See more